Book Description
Eillie, a young American photojournalist, finds herself in Jerusalem in 1947. She unwittingly become a pawn in a political chess game when she photographs ancient scrolls discovered by Bedouins. Through it all, Ellie discovers a people, a spirit, and a person who profoundly change the direction of her life.
